PROBLEM
On July 19th, 2024, CrowdStrike released an update to their Falcon monitoring software, causing a crash in Windows operating systems. Both CrowdStrike and Microsoft promptly issued fixes and mitigation steps to help users recover affected systems. However, after recovery, ArcGIS Enterprise users reported issues with components not starting properly. These issues were traced back to the corruption of ArcGIS Enterprise configuration files, which were impacted by the operating system crash. This issue is tracked by Esri as BUG-000169285: "Update to the CrowdStrike software results in failure of ArcGIS Enterprise components installed on affected machines."
If your ArcGIS Enterprise deployment was affected by the CrowdStrike outage, log a support case with Esri Technical Support for assistance in resolving the problem. Due to the varying nature of the configuration file corruption, please refrain from attempting to resolve the issues on your own by editing the files or using files from other deployments.
